An Electrochemical Technique for Removing Thin Uniform Layers of Gold

Abstract
A reproducible and accurate electrochemical technique for the removal of extremely thin (20Aå–4000Aå) uniform layers of gold has been developed. The removal was achieved by anodizing at constant current in and subsequent stripping in . An extension of the technique allows the relatively rapid (25 µm/hr) removal of gold from single crystals in a strainfree manner. Calibration curves are shown and experimental details described.
